Question: Hi Doctor,
I had a bad habit of excessive masturbation till few years ago but I overcame it and reduced it greatly. However, now I am facing another problem.

I have been diagnosed with urinary tract infection with Enterococcs faecalis with colony count 100,000+. I don't know how this is possible since I did not have sexual contact with any person ever. This infection was discovered only in urine culture. Complete urine examination and complete blood profile test came completely normal. My WBC in blood is 5000/cumm,pus cells in urine were 2-4/hpf, epithelial cells in urine is 1-2/hpf whereas RBC, crystals ,casts and others were not found in urine.
Is it possible that urine culture was somehow contaminated from elsewhere and that I should go for a retest of urine culture?
Suppose urine culture is correct then why are WBC count and urine examination report show completely normal? How could I have contracted this infection?
Is it completely curable? Are there chances of relapse? Are there things to avoid or consume for treating this?
Currently I have been prescribed Pantodac, nitrofurantoin and citralka.

Brief Answer:
Need to take appropriate antibiotic as per culture report .

Detailed Answer:
Hello
Thanks for your query ,based on the facts that you have posted it appears that your urine culture has revealed you to have UTI due to Enterococcus Faecalis organisms .

Enterococci are part of the normal intestinal flora of human and from there they can spread and cause UTI.

It is not necessary that the infection due to Enterococci will be relected and detected in routine urine analysis and WBC count ,

This is most notorious bacteria infection and the bacteria are resistant to almost all commonly used antibiotics being used to treat UTI .

Taking combination of antibiotics like Ampicillin and Amynoglycosides (Gentamycin) taken for 4-6 weeks do help to eradicate infection .

1. I didn't have any sexual contact. Still somehow I got it on my own. What are the possible / most common reason for the bacteria spread to from intestine to urinary tract? Based on this answer I will take precautions to avoid some activities / food

2. Currently I have been prescribed Pantodac, nitrofurantoin and citralka for 5 days only. Are these a good combination? Is 5 days enough because doctor didn't even say to come back after 5 days?

3. Can this happen again?

4. How can I be sure that I am cured? Currently, I do not have burns while urinating or pain etc. Only reason doctor asked for urine culture is because I mentioned that I felt some discharge happened sometime.

Brief Answer:
Read answers as detailed below .

Detailed Answer:
hello
Thanks for follow up here are the answers to your queries point to point

1) Infection from intestinal flora spreads to urinary tract via urethra due to its close proximity to anus .
2) Since these organisms are resistant to almost all commonly used antibiotics Nitrofurantoin alone will not help to eradicate infection .
3) Pantodac is a H2 receptor antagonist it is prescribed to avoid getting gastritis from Nitrofurantoin
4) Repeat urine culture after you finish the course of suggested antibiotics for 6 weeks .
